Summary

This pilot study tests a new technology called inDrop RNA-Seq to analyze individual immune cells in detail. Researchers will use it to study how healthy adults respond to the yellow fever vaccine, which is known to be very effective. The goal is to identify the specific cell types and genes that drive a strong immune response, which could help improve future vaccines.

What this could lead to
If successful, this could reveal which cell types and genes are key for a strong vaccine response, potentially guiding better vaccine design.
What could go wrong
This is a very small pilot study with only 6 participants, so findings may not apply broadly. The technology is also new and unproven for this purpose.
